The AMD Ryzen 7 5700 is an 8-core, 16-thread desktop processor designed for exceptional performance, featuring a max boost of 4.6 GHz and advanced Zen 3 architecture. It comes unlocked for overclocking and includes a premium Wraith Spire Cooler, making it a perfect choice for gamers and professionals alike.

Good deal for the price despite not being the best of its segment
The processor has given me a boost of 20% performance in gaming, my previous one from the 3000 series was kinda bottlenecking my system due to only having 6 threads. This processor is good for my system since im still on the am4 platform, my advice is to update the BIOS to latest version before you actually assemble it - i had an old bios, at first it wasnt recognizing the CPU, mounted my old 3500x back, updated bios and i was good to go.

Cooler Came Jacked Up, Processor is a Beast
Replaced an i5-8400 with this guy. Was good for the price, but I had to replace the cooler. On paper, this thing is supposed to handle things just fine (TDP for TDP). In reality...different story. I was monitoring system temps while performing basic tasks and they were always abnormally high (50C idle, 70C at 40% load). This was with the stock thermal paste.I ended up having to take my rig back apart and inspected the surfaces for both my CPU and the cooler. CPU was smooth as butter. Cooler? Not so much. Saw a few gouges and a couple small pieces of metal in the compound. Hoping that I could compensate with a good thermal paste and verifying good application, I saw absolutely no change in temperatures. Sadly, the cooler comes bundled with the processor so best I can hope for is the AMD RMA process, which nobody has time for. Conclusion? Just get your own cooler, even if you get this processor. Hopefully mine was just messed up at the factory, but it wasn't cutting the mustard on light tasks, which means it would have been hurting under heavy load.Thankfully, there is more than just the cooler in this package. The processor itself is, to put it lightly, in a different league than the 8400. Cold boot? 6 seconds. Shutting down? 2.5 seconds. Windows 10 installs faster than you can blink. It's more than sufficiently fast for my needs so far, especially coming from the experience I had with the 8400.Apparently there's controversy around the 5700 being a 5700g with the APU disabled. Coming in from being an Intel guy for so long, I really have no basis for comparison. I ended up with a bunch more cores, threads, fabrics, rebars, gidgets, and gadgets than I had before.For the price I paid, even with having to get another cooler, it's worth it. Would I have enjoyed a frustration-free experience for a few extra bucks? Heck yeah. That cooler was polished with a brillo pad and it almost makes me wonder if I was working with a refurb in disguise, but I digress. Still worth it. Now happy to be on team red.
